EWGENBAR ;Barcode voor op magazijnrekken[ 12/18/2003 10:28 AM ] TEST Set Dev=0 quit Set Max=1 ;Set Dev=$$OPEN^vhDEV($$DIRUSER^vhDEV,"BARCODE.TXT","W") Set Dev=103 Open Dev ; HALUX zonder vertaling Use Dev ; print code Do TBXLBL Close:0'[Dev Dev Quit TBXLBL Write "M90,5,15",! Write "GK""*""",! Write "GM""TBX""",^IPCom("CS","TBXDZ",0),! Do WRITE($NAME(^IPCom("CS","TBXDZ"))) Q Write ! Write "ON",! Write "N",! Write "A525,50,1,3,2,2,N,""TESTING TANDEMBOX""",! Write "GG180,50,""TBX""",! Write "P1",! Quit WRITE(Ref) Set I=0 For Set I=$O(@Ref@(I)) Quit:I="" Do .W @Ref@(I) Quit GANGLIST Set Dev=0 ;Set Dev=$$OPEN^vhDEV($$DIRUSER^vhDEV,"BARCODE.TXT","W") Set Dev="|PRN|\\NOTES01\OVHALUX TXT LABEL" Open Dev ; OV HALUX Use Dev Set Mag="2" Set Gang="3" Do GANG(Mag,Gang,32,32,1,1) Close:0'[Dev Dev Quit GANG(Mag,Gang,XL,XH,YL,YH) For X=XL:1:XH For Y=YL:1:YH Do .Set String=$TR($J(Mag,2)_$J(Gang,2)_$J(X,2)_$J(Y,2)," ","0") .Write !,"N",! .Write "B500,50,1,1,6,15,350,N,""",String,"""",! .Write "A130,90,1,5,2,1,N,""",$E(String,1,2)," ",$E(String,3,4)," ",$E(String,5,6)," ",$E(String,7,8),"""",! .Write "P1",!